Well you can always use MSGED as the basis of your editor, whether
you wish to make a commercial product out of it or not.  Golded
was supposedly created by modifying MSGED.  What is it you don't
like about MSGED anyway?  At the moment, the only non-PD stuff in
MSGED is the version 7 nodelist lookup, the MSGAPI library and
some userlist lookup which I am not sure what does, but it's only 
a small amount of code so I am planning on reading it to find out
what the specs are and rewriting it.  BFN.
